Took my Mum here for a belated mothers day treat. Was planning on just having coffee and snacks but ended up getting breakfast and it was fantastic! $35 dollars for 3 full plate breakfasts plus coffee, tea, and a glass of the house made Strawberry Long Island Iced Tea. You can't beat that price! The new owners and staff are amazing and this is definitely a new go-to spot for myself and my family! Pic is of the breakfast- eggs, rosemary potatoes, bacon and fresh french bread toast!! Also love the open space! It's very accessible which is awesome since quite a few of my friends and family have mobility issues and the assortment of locally made gifts and crafts for sale was cool too. Great to see small/local businesses supporting each other and our community!

I'm really trying to embrace the changes made to this bakery, but my last two visits have been very disappointing. The cinnamon buns, at $4 apiece (which I would be happy to pay for a good treat) are weird. They are overly salty and pale. No discernible taste of cinnamon. I would say they were inedible, but as a sugar addict I managed to choke mine down. My daughter rejected hers. The florescent yellow lemon poppy seed muffins...again, just weird. Not sweet enough, rubbery texture. Was excited to see the familiar crusty rolls, but they need to be renamed chewy rolls. Nothing crusty about them. Are there red seal bakers on staff, or are staff still learning how to bake? Though I appreciate the philosophy behind this business, I'm not sure I can support it unless quality improves dramatically.

I’m 26 and have been going to this bakery since I was 6. Something about the old timesy feel, the grand selection of baked goods and confections, and the overall atmosphere was comforting. This place held a special place in my hear for the majority of my life. That being said.. Coming in today, I was appalled by the dramatic change and modernization of the place. It felt like a chunk of my childhood was ripped away from me and I was met with just another “modern” bakery. I sympathize to all the older clientele as I know this was a town favourite for many, but with the new design, menu, and atmosphere, I was extremely disappointed. Prices have skyrocketed, all my menu favourites have been disposed of, all the staff I’ve grown to love over the years are gone, and everything I loved about this quaint little bakery have all but vanished. I understand the strive for change, growth and progress, but this was the wrong place to instate such a change. To everyone who shares my view on this, I’m sorry we had to lose such a gem. My heart goes out to all the old clientele who still dream of the good ol’ days. Sorry to say, but after 20 years of loyalty to the Nanaimo Bakery, I will never come back again.

Nanaimo Baker & Confectionary. Just amazing to find such a place in a city of this size. The pastry: "Torten" German style, cakes, danish pastry, cookies, etc. are simply excellent and much cheaper than any place else and they offer a good selection. They also make their own chocolates, truffles or soups which I have not tried. The seating is quite comfortable and stylish. Neither Vancouver nor Seattle have anything comparable to offer. You can also buy home-made bread. Enjoy your lunch repast, but revel in your afternoon coffee and cake.
